Output 10af87cf99eaa4bc660c82a1465c7b37abfc0135d0489b4718b3c0acad29b375:56

value
1060176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b31cc423e6c3a52fca5204af72912900746f3fca OP_EQUAL
address
3J25LbBSFVgaCZZUHdqYRPPo7cxWti31tE
transaction
10af87cf99eaa4bc660c82a1465c7b37abfc0135d0489b4718b3c0acad29b375
confirmations
234190
spent
true